| Today's News-Herald, Lake Havasu City, AZ >>> Published on Friday, May 12, 2017 <<< >>> Feb. 25, 1924 – May 5, 2017 <<< Frances “Kay” Bothmann passed away in Lake Havasu City May 5. She was born in Redondo Beach, California to Frank and Florence Thomen. Kay graduated from Dorsey High School in Los Angeles. She then attended both Midland College in Fremont, Nebraska and the University of Southern California. Kay married John Bothmann at Grace Lutheran Church in Los Angeles, California on Nov. 21, 1945. They had four children. After her children were grown, Kay worked at the Hacienda Heights High School District in California for 16 years as an account clerk. Kay and John loved to square dance. They had many lifelong childhood friends from church. Her faith was an in integral part of her daily life. She was always learning a new craft and most recently enjoyed making very intricate greeting cards for her family and friends. Kay was loved by everyone who met her. She was and always will be a very special part of all of our lives. Kay is survived by her sister, Patricia; daughters, Nancy and Susan; son, James; many grandchildren, great-grandchildren, and one great-great grandchild. She was preceded in death by her parents, Frank and Florence; husband, John; son, William. Services will be held at a later date in California.
